About the book

A mini-book written with understanding on the blessings and challenges of raising grandchildren with disabilities

Kings and queens wear crowns, but the Bible says grandkids are crowns to their grandparents (Prov. 17:6). But what if your crown is not what you expected? What if your grandchild has a disability? This mini-book offers grandparents their rightful place as kings and queens to their families. If the Lord has blessed you with a grandchild that has a disability, then roll up your sleeves and get ready to polish that precious and beautiful crown!

About the author

Dave Deuel, Ph.D., is Senior Research Fellow and Policy Advisor at the Christian Institute at Joni and Friends, and Academic Dean Emeritus, the Master’s Academy International. In addition to serving in seminary and pastoral ministry he also serves in advisory and policy roles for disability organizations including the State Council on Disability for California.
